from PyQt4 import QtCore, QtGui, uic
from PyQt4.QtCore import pyqtSignal, pyqtSlot
from PIL import Image, ImageDraw, ImageFont
from PIL.ImageQt import ImageQt
import core
import numpy
import subprocess as sp
import sys
class Worker(QtCore.QObject):
videoCreated = pyqtSignal()
progressBarUpdate = pyqtSignal(int)
progressBarSetText = pyqtSignal(str)
def __init__(self, parent=None):
QtCore.QObject.__init__(self)
self.core = core.Core()
self.core.settings = parent.settings
self.modules = parent.modules
self.stackedWidget = parent.window.stackedWidget
parent.videoTask.connect(self.createVideo)
@pyqtSlot(str, str, str, list)
def createVideo(self, backgroundImage, inputFile, outputFile, components):
# print('worker thread id: {}'.format(QtCore.QThread.currentThreadId()))
def getBackgroundAtIndex(i):
return self.core.drawBaseImage(backgroundFrames[i])
progressBarValue = 0
self.progressBarUpdate.emit(progressBarValue)
self.progressBarSetText.emit('Loading background image…')
backgroundFrames = self.core.parseBaseImage(backgroundImage)
if len(backgroundFrames) < 2:
# the base image is not a video so we can draw it now
imBackground = getBackgroundAtIndex(0)
else:
# base images will be drawn while drawing the audio bars
imBackground = None
self.progressBarSetText.emit('Loading audio file…')
completeAudioArray = self.core.readAudioFile(inputFile)
# test if user has libfdk_aac
encoders = sp.check_output(self.core.FFMPEG_BIN + " -encoders -hide_banner", shell=True)
acodec = self.core.settings.value('outputAudioCodec')
if b'libfdk_aac' in encoders and acodec == 'aac':
acodec = 'libfdk_aac'
ffmpegCommand = [ self.core.FFMPEG_BIN,
'-y', # (optional) means overwrite the output file if it already exists.
'-f', 'rawvideo',
'-vcodec', 'rawvideo',
'-s', self.core.settings.value('outputWidth')+'x'+self.core.settings.value('outputHeight'), # size of one frame
'-pix_fmt', 'rgb24',
'-r', self.core.settings.value('outputFrameRate'), # frames per second
'-i', '-', # The input comes from a pipe
'-an',
'-i', inputFile,
'-acodec', acodec, # output audio codec
'-b:a', self.core.settings.value('outputAudioBitrate'),
'-vcodec', self.core.settings.value('outputVideoCodec'),
'-pix_fmt', self.core.settings.value('outputVideoFormat'),
'-preset', self.core.settings.value('outputPreset'),
'-f', self.core.settings.value('outputFormat')]
if acodec == 'aac':
ffmpegCommand.append('-strict')
ffmpegCommand.append('-2')
ffmpegCommand.append(outputFile)
out_pipe = sp.Popen(ffmpegCommand,
stdin=sp.PIPE,stdout=sys.stdout, stderr=sys.stdout)
# initialize components
print('######################## Data')
print('loaded components:',
["%s%s" % (num, str(component)) for num, component in enumerate(components)])
staticComponents = {}
sampleSize = 1470
for compNo, comp in enumerate(components):
properties = None
properties = comp.preFrameRender(worker=self, completeAudioArray=completeAudioArray, sampleSize=sampleSize)
if properties and 'static' in properties:
staticComponents[compNo] = None
# create video for output
numpy.seterr(divide='ignore')
frame = getBackgroundAtIndex(0)
bgI = 0
for i in range(0, len(completeAudioArray), sampleSize):
newFrame = Image.new("RGBA", (int(self.core.settings.value('outputWidth')), int(self.core.settings.value('outputHeight'))),(0,0,0,255))
if imBackground:
newFrame.paste(imBackground)
else:
newFrame.paste(getBackgroundAtIndex(bgI))
# composite all frames returned by the components in order
for compNo, comp in enumerate(components):
if compNo in staticComponents and staticComponents[compNo] != None:
newFrame = Image.alpha_composite(newFrame,staticComponents[compNo])
else:
newFrame = Image.alpha_composite(newFrame,comp.frameRender(compNo, i))
if i == 0 and compNo in staticComponents:
staticComponents[compNo] = comp.frameRender(compNo, i)
if not imBackground:
# increment background video frame for next iteration
if bgI < len(backgroundFrames)-1:
bgI += 1
# write to out_pipe
try:
frame = Image.new("RGB", (int(self.core.settings.value('outputWidth')), int(self.core.settings.value('outputHeight'))),(0,0,0))
frame.paste(newFrame)
out_pipe.stdin.write(frame.tobytes())
finally:
True
# increase progress bar value
if progressBarValue + 1 <= (i / len(completeAudioArray)) * 100:
progressBarValue = numpy.floor((i / len(completeAudioArray)) * 100)
self.progressBarUpdate.emit(progressBarValue)
self.progressBarSetText.emit('%s%%' % str(int(progressBarValue)))
numpy.seterr(all='print')
out_pipe.stdin.close()
if out_pipe.stderr is not None:
print(out_pipe.stderr.read())
out_pipe.stderr.close()
# out_pipe.terminate() # don't terminate ffmpeg too early
out_pipe.wait()
print("Video file created")
self.core.deleteTempDir()
self.progressBarUpdate.emit(100)
self.progressBarSetText.emit('100%')
self.videoCreated.emit()
